First Look: 'Escapepion' - Playdate Game
Escapepion is a short vertical shooting game for the Playdate.

"It came about when the subject of the old arcade game Exerion came up on a video about SG-1000 games I was watching a few weeks ago, which had me wondering if I could get something that had a similar terrain effect working on the Playdate. I was pretty much just going to leave things there, but then I contracted Covid and found myself needing something to do for a week whilst I tried to avoid coughing up a lung.
I'm basically just saying that there was about a week and half of work involved in this. Mostly whilst I was ill."
The game features three exciting modes:-
ESCAPE MISSION - the standard mode. Shoot things, don't die, the usual kind of vertical shooting stuff. You only get one life, though. Takes about 5 minutes to clear if you know what you are doing, but as always with these things, that's the trick.
ENDURANCE - An infinite mode in which the game will throw wave after wave of ships at you. It's randomised using a fixed seed, so it should theoretically prove the same experience every time for those of you who want to challenge just how far you can go.
DAILY - Like Endurance, but it uses the current date as part of the random number generation. Also you can only play each day once. Good luck!
CONTROLS
D-Pad - Move your ship one of eight luxurious directions.
B - Hold this down to shoot. Probably a good idea.
A - Hold this down to make your ship move a little slower. Useful for navigating tricky situations!

"Playdate is familiar, but unlike anything you've ever seen. It has a very special black and white screen – not backlit, but super reflective – that looks way more amazing than you're probably imagining.
It also has a peppy little processor,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, and a surprisingly loud loudspeaker. And when you're not using it, the screen doesn't turn off – it becomes a very nice low-power clock!
The Design
Thanks to our friends at Teenage Engineering, Playdate looks incredible. It's colorful. It fits in your pocket. And we worked hard to make sure buttons feel perfectly clicky and that the crank action is silky smooth.
The Crank
Yes, the crank. Is it a gimmick? Nah. Does it charge the Playdate's battery? Nope. Is it really fun? Yes yes yes! It's an analog controller that flips out from the side, allowing you to precisely dial in the action.
The Season
Here's the truly unique bit. Playdate isn't just an empty system. Once you set up your Playdate, you'll start to receive two brand new games... every week. For 12 weeks.
That's 24 free games, in lots of genres. Some are short. Some are long. Will you love them all? Probably not. Will you have a great time trying them? Absolutely."
